Set against the storied grounds of the Acropolis of Rethymno, this design-forward editorial reframes the ancient fortress not as a relic of the past, but as a canvas for connection and romance. Inspired by the Fortezza Fortress’s three distinct historical phases, Gigi & Roses envisioned a series of immersive setups, each echoing a different chapter of the site’s layered legacy, while inviting a contemporary love story to unfold among the ruins.
At the heart of it all is a couple, whose quiet intimacy is framed by a beautiful honey-ochre limestone that pairs perfectly with orange tones of floral comopsitions. Light becomes its own language here. A sculptural LED ring encircles the couple in a modern halo, and a projected orange moon casts a tender glow—part celestial, part cinematic. These bespoke installations do more than illuminate the space, they hold the emotion in place, casting romance as something sacred and enduring.
In this quiet collision of past and present, history becomes the heartbeat of a love story—one where every shadow and every flicker of light speaks of beginnings, not endings.
